Understanding and Maintaining the MAP Sensor on Your 2000 Nissan Navara

The 2000 Nissan Navara does come equipped with a MAP (Manifold Absolute Pressure) sensor. This crucial component plays a vital role in the vehicle's performance by measuring the air pressure within the intake manifold and sending this information to the engine control unit (ECU). This data is essential for determining the optimal air-fuel mix for efficient combustion. When it comes to MAP sensor maintenance or replacement, here are a few pointers to keep in mind.

Firstly, let's talk about the signs that may indicate a faulty MAP sensor. Symptoms can include:

  • Poor fuel economy or increased emissions.
  • Engine misfires or rough idling.
  • Hesitation or stalling during acceleration.
  • Check engine light activation.

If you notice any of these issues, it's a good idea to investigate the MAP sensor as a potential source. Regular servicing of your Navara should include checking the sensor's condition. A malfunctioning MAP sensor can disrupt fuel delivery and timing, leading to reduced performance and possibly more severe engine problems.

When it comes to replacing the MAP sensor, it's a relatively straightforward task that doesn't require a lot of heavy tools. However, having the right approach is crucial:

  1. Ensure your vehicle is cool and safely parked.
  2. Disconnect the battery to prevent any electrical issues.
  3. Locate the MAP sensor, usually found near the intake manifold. In the 2000 Navara, it's positioned near the throttle body.
  4. Carefully unplug the electrical connector from the sensor.
  5. Remove any mounting hardware and take out the old sensor.
  6. Install the new sensor, ensuring a secure fit, and reconnect the electrical connector.
  7. Reattach the battery connection and start the engine to ensure everything is functioning correctly.
